#### Red Bull’s Bold Move: Yuki Tsunoda Steps in for Lawson to Partner Verstappen

In a dramatic turn of events in the world of Formula 1, Red Bull Racing has announced a significant driver change, placing Japanese sensation Yuki Tsunoda alongside Max Verstappen. This shake-up comes as the team gears up for the Japanese Grand Prix, marking a strategic pivot in their 2025 season lineup.

#### A Surprising Swap: Tsunoda Replaces Lawson

Liam Lawson, who was selected over Tsunoda to fill Sergio Perez’s seat only last December, finds himself replaced after a mere two races. Despite being touted for his mental resilience and potential, Lawson failed to impress during his brief stint. Struggling to advance past Q1 in both races he participated in, the New Zealander qualified last in China and didn’t score any points at either event.

#### Behind the Decision: Experience Over Potential

The decision to bring in Tsunoda was not made lightly. Following a tumultuous performance at the Chinese Grand Prix, Red Bull’s key stakeholders concluded that Tsunoda’s extensive experience would be invaluable. Team principal Christian Horner emphasized that the change was a “purely sporting decision,” aimed at bolstering their chances to retain the World Drivers’ Championship and reclaim the Constructors’ title.

#### Horner’s Perspective

Horner acknowledged the challenges Lawson faced with the RB21, noting that Tsunoda’s familiarity and expertise could be pivotal in refining the car’s performance. “It has been difficult to see Liam struggle with the RB21 at the first two races,” Horner stated. “Yuki’s experience will prove highly beneficial in helping to develop the current car.”

#### Tsunoda’s Track Record

Entering his fifth season, Tsunoda brings a wealth of experience to Red Bull. With a career-best finish of fourth place in Abu Dhabi during his rookie season, he recently finished sixth in the Sprint race in China, securing Racing Bulls’ first points of the season. Although he qualified fifth in Australia, changing conditions thwarted his chances for a podium finish.

#### The Future for Lawson

For Lawson, the move back to Racing Bulls, where he previously completed 11 races as a substitute driver, offers an opportunity for growth. Horner expressed confidence in Lawson’s potential, stating, “We have a duty of care to protect and develop Liam.” He emphasized the importance of providing Lawson with an environment where he can regain confidence and continue his Formula 1 journey.

This strategic shake-up at Red Bull Racing highlights the intense pressure and high stakes of Formula 1, where decisions are made swiftly to maximize performance and championship potential. As the season unfolds, all eyes will be on Tsunoda as he steps into this pivotal role alongside Verstappen.
